Pros and Cons

  • Positives
  • Negatives

Ather 450X

  • Very light and nimble to handle
  • Warp mode is very quick and fun to use
  • Range prediction is very accurate
  • Build quality is of the highest order

Bajaj Chetak

  • Top-notch build and paint quality
  • Performance is easily on par with 110cc petrol scooters
  • Extremely comfortable rider’s seat

Ather 450X

  • Ride quality is a bit on the firmer side
  • With the portable charger underseat storage gets full very easily
  • Key features can only be unlocked with the Pro pack

Bajaj Chetak

  • Not much room for a pillion
  • Ride quality at speed feels a little harsh
  • The speedometer is difficult to read under bright sunlight

Q. What is the difference between Athers 450 plus and Athers 450X?
  • Ather offers its electric scooter in two trims: 450X and 450 Plus. The 450 Plus, while new, arrives in the same tune as the old 450. Peak power is restricted to 5.4kW, while the claimed true range is 70km. It does 0-40kmph in 3.9 seconds. Torque is bumped up to 22Nm on the Plus. The 450X is for the more performance-oriented buyer. You get extra power, more torque and the Warp riding mode, which spools up the electric motor enough to scare you silly. Q. What is the difference between Bajaj Chetak Urbane and Bajaj Chetak Premium?
  • The main distinguishing factor between the Urbane and the Premium variant is that the latter gets a front disc brake with metallic-finish rims in the shade Slate Grey or Satin Black. More subtle changes on the Urbane trim include either a black or medium grey seat cover, Siberian silver bezels, black plastic floor mats, and two glossy solid colours. Comparatively, the Premium trim gets tan-coloured seats, Satin silver bezels, dark grey floor mats, and four glossy metallic colours.
